M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    Preenchimento de campo obrigatório com condicionalidade.

    Compartilhe

    GILDEZIO
    Intermediário
    Intermediário

    Respeito às Regras 50%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 87
    Registrado : 23/04/2014

    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  GILDEZIO em Dom 23 Abr 2017, 20:19

    Boa tarde amigos tenho um botão seleção no formulário que eu marco quando a solicitação já foi atendida e campo data que coloco a data que a solicitação foi atendida. Gostaria que quando for marcada a seleção tornasse obrigatório e preenchimento da data. Isso invitaria que a solicitação ficasse sem a data que foi atendida.
    avatar
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3672
    Registrado : 20/04/2011

    Re: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  Silvio em Seg 24 Abr 2017, 12:39

    Bom dia.

    Vamos inverter a situação aqui, vamos primeiro preencher o campo data,forçando dessa maneira o preenchimento.

    No evento click do botão.

    If ISNULL ( me.campodata ) or me.campodata = "" then
    msgbox( "Campo data é de preenchimento obrigatório", vbcritical, " ...AVISO..."
    me.campodata.setfocus
    else
    exit sub
    endif


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    [Você precisa estar registrado e conectado para ver este link.]

    GILDEZIO
    Intermediário
    Intermediário

    Respeito às Regras 50%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 87
    Registrado : 23/04/2014

    Re: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  GILDEZIO em Qua 26 Abr 2017, 23:24

    amigo o código resolveu em parte ele solicita que coloque a data mas não a torna obrigatória ou seja o fomulário salve sem preencher a data.
    avatar
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3672
    Registrado : 20/04/2011

    Re: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  Silvio em Qui 27 Abr 2017, 00:05

    Coloque também no evento ao salvar o mesmo código...veja o que acontece quando tentar salvar sem data

    No evento click do botão salvar.

    If ISNULL ( me.campodata ) or me.campodata = "" then
    msgbox( "Campo data é de preenchimento obrigatório", vbcritical, " ...AVISO..."
    me.campodata.setfocus
    else
    exit sub
    endif


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    [Você precisa estar registrado e conectado para ver este link.]

    GILDEZIO
    Intermediário
    Intermediário

    Respeito às Regras 50%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 87
    Registrado : 23/04/2014

    Re: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  GILDEZIO em Ter 02 Maio 2017, 22:03

    resolvido
    avatar
    Alexandre Neves
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 6505
    Registrado : 05/11/2009

    Re: Preenchimento de campo obrigatório com condicionalidade.

    Mensagem  Alexandre Neves em Dom 11 Jun 2017, 20:23

    Marque o Resolvido


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o

      Data/hora atual: Ter 21 Nov 2017, 19:24